WITTON Albion’s bid to return to the UniBond Premier at the first time of asking sees the Wincham Park club take to the road for their opening-day fixture at Spalding United.

The League released the First Division South fixtures on Wednesday and Gary Finley’s men have two home clashes in the space of a week.

After the opening-day journey to the Tulips of Lincolnshire, Witton host Rushall Olympic on Tuesday, August 18 (7.45pm) and then Belper Town on Saturday, August 22 (3pm).

On Tuesday, September 15, Albion travel to the oldest club in the world when they play Sheffield FC (7.45pm). On Boxing Day, Witton host familiar foes Cammell Laird (3pm) and on New Year’s Day, rivals Leek Town are the hosts.

Witton finish the league season on Saturday, April 24, 2010, when they host Loughborough Dynamo (3pm).

Should Witton need them, the promotion play-off semi-finals will be held week commencing April 26 with the final due to be played on Saturday, May 1.
